Sunderland prepares for complete lineup overhaul in League Cup tie with Hull City
Summary

Sunderland prepares for an entirely different starting XI for tonight’s League Cup match against Hull City at the Stadium of Light. Manager Le Bris intends to utilize this fixture to manage player fitness and offer competitive minutes to squad members with limited recent playing time. Melker Ellborg is expected to start in goal, while new signing Jules Ahoka is slated to make his debut in midfield. Defensive changes include a likely partnership between Luke O’Nien and Omar Alderete, alongside a first appearance for Dayann Methalie. The forward line may feature Wilson Isidor and Jocelin Ta Bi as the club balances the need for recovery following a busy schedule with the requirement to build chemistry among team members.
